
要将多行数据粘到Excel中的一格,可以使用ALT+ENTER、合并单元格、使用公式和VBA宏。在这里,我们将重点介绍如何使用ALT+ENTER功能来详细描述其步骤和效果。
要将多行数据粘到一格,最简单的方法是使用Excel中的ALT+ENTER功能。首先,选中你要输入数据的单元格,输入第一行数据,然后按下ALT键不放,再按ENTER键。这样Excel会将光标移动到同一单元格的下一行,你可以继续输入第二行数据。通过这种方式,你可以在同一个单元格中输入多行数据。注意,虽然这些数据在视觉上是多行显示,但在Excel中它们仍然属于同一个单元格。
一、ALT+ENTER快捷键使用
1、基本操作步骤
ALT+ENTER是最简单的方法之一,用于在Excel单元格中添加多行文本。具体操作步骤如下:
- 选中目标单元格:点击你希望输入多行数据的单元格。
- 输入第一行数据:直接输入你想要的第一行内容。
- 使用ALT+ENTER:按住ALT键,然后按ENTER键。光标会移动到同一单元格的下一行。
- 继续输入:继续输入你的第二行数据,并重复上述步骤,直到所有数据都输入完毕。
2、优点和缺点
优点:
- 操作简单:不需要任何复杂的配置或设置,适合快速输入少量多行文本。
- 灵活性高:可以随时在同一单元格中添加新行。
缺点:
- 不适合大量数据:如果需要粘贴大量多行数据,手动操作会非常繁琐。
- 格式限制:对文本格式的控制有限,复杂的文本格式可能无法准确保留。
二、合并单元格
1、基本操作步骤
合并单元格是另一种将多行数据显示在一格的方式。具体操作步骤如下:
- 选择多个单元格:点击并拖动鼠标,选择你希望合并的多个单元格。
- 点击“合并单元格”按钮:在Excel工具栏中找到并点击“合并单元格”按钮。通常在“开始”选项卡的“对齐”部分。
- 输入数据:在合并后的单元格中输入数据,按ALT+ENTER换行。
2、优点和缺点
优点:
- 显示整洁:合并单元格后,数据看起来更加整齐有序。
- 适合展示:适合在报告或展示中使用,视觉效果更好。
缺点:
- 数据处理不便:合并后的单元格在数据处理、排序和筛选时会变得复杂。
- 操作相对复杂:需要更多的步骤和时间,适合有较高要求的场景。
三、使用公式
1、基本操作步骤
使用Excel公式也可以将多行数据合并到一个单元格中。常用的公式包括CONCATENATE和TEXTJOIN。以下是使用TEXTJOIN公式的具体步骤:
- 准备数据:在多个单元格中输入你需要合并的数据。
- 输入公式:在目标单元格中输入TEXTJOIN公式,例如
=TEXTJOIN(CHAR(10), TRUE, A1:A3),其中CHAR(10)代表换行符,A1:A3是你需要合并的数据范围。 - 执行公式:按ENTER键,公式会自动将数据合并并显示在目标单元格中。
2、优点和缺点
优点:
- 自动化高:可以批量处理大量数据,效率高。
- 灵活性强:可以根据需要自定义合并方式和格式。
缺点:
- 公式复杂:需要熟悉Excel公式,初学者可能会觉得复杂。
- 动态性差:如果源数据变化,需要重新计算公式。
四、使用VBA宏
1、基本操作步骤
使用VBA宏可以实现更复杂的数据合并和处理。以下是一个简单的VBA宏示例,用于将选中单元格中的数据合并到一个单元格中:
- 打开VBA编辑器:按ALT+F11打开VBA编辑器。
- 插入模块:在VBA编辑器中,插入一个新的模块。
- 输入代码:在模块中输入以下代码:
Sub MergeCells()Dim cell As Range
Dim mergedText As String
For Each cell In Selection
mergedText = mergedText & cell.Value & vbCrLf
Next cell
Selection.ClearContents
Selection.Cells(1, 1).Value = mergedText
End Sub
- 运行宏:返回Excel,选中需要合并的单元格,按ALT+F8运行宏。
2、优点和缺点
优点:
- 高度自定义:可以根据需求自定义宏代码,实现复杂的数据处理。
- 效率高:一次性处理大量数据,适合大规模数据操作。
缺点:
- 技术要求高:需要一定的VBA编程基础,初学者可能不易掌握。
- 维护复杂:宏代码需要定期维护和更新,以适应新的需求。
总结起来,使用ALT+ENTER、合并单元格、使用公式和VBA宏都是将多行数据粘到Excel一格中的有效方法。ALT+ENTER适合快速输入少量数据,合并单元格适合展示,公式适合自动化处理,VBA宏适合大规模数据处理和高度自定义需求。根据你的具体需求选择合适的方法,可以大大提高工作效率和数据处理效果。
相关问答FAQs:
1. 如何将多行数据粘贴到一个单元格中?
- 在Excel中,选中要粘贴的单元格。
- 按下Ctrl+V,将多行数据粘贴到选定的单元格中。
- 如果数据超过单元格的宽度,则可以通过调整列宽或使用自动换行功能来显示全部数据。
2. 如何在Excel中将多行数据合并为一行?
- 在Excel中,选中要合并的多行数据。
- 右键单击选中的行,选择“剪切”。
- 在目标单元格中右键单击,选择“粘贴”。
3. 如何将多行数据合并为一个单元格,并用换行符分隔?
- 在Excel中,选中要合并的多行数据。
- 右键单击选中的行,选择“剪切”。
- 在目标单元格中右键单击,选择“粘贴特殊”。
- 在弹出的窗口中选择“值”,并勾选“转换为换行符分隔的文本”选项,然后点击“确定”。这样,多行数据将合并为一个单元格,并且每行数据之间用换行符分隔。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4362594